Foundation Overview
Based in Middleboro, MA, David J Harb Charitable Trust has awarded 64 grants totaling $316,000 to organizations in Massachusetts, Tennessee and 5 other states across the US. Individual grants range from $500 to $22,000, with a median award of $2,000.

Geographic Focus
53% of grants are awarded in Massachusetts, with additional funding distributed across 6 other locations. The foundation balances regional focus with broader geographic diversity. Within Massachusetts, funding concentrates in Norwood (59%), Boston (18%), Westwood (12%).

Form 990-PF Research Tips
-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
-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
-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
-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
